Method and apparatus for vehicle rollover mitigation
First Claim
1. A method for detecting a potential for a vehicle rollover event, the method comprising the steps of:
- determining a lateral kinetic energy of the vehicle based on vehicle longitudinal velocity and vehicle side slip angle;
measuring a lateral acceleration of the vehicle;
measuring a tire load;
determining a rollover potentiality index based on the lateral kinetic energy and the lateral acceleration;
determining a rollover index by weighting the rollover potentiality index by a factor of the lateral acceleration and a factor of the tire load;
determining if the rollover index is above a predetermined threshold; and
outputting an indication based on the above-determined indexes to a controller adapted to provide a control action in response thereto;
wherein the measured tire load, which is used in determining the rollover index, is determined by measuring a length of a contact patch of a vehicle tire and measuring changes to the contact patch length and;
further comprising the step of providing a control signal from a controller configured to output a control signal to a system of the vehicle to implement corrective action to reduce the potential of an actual rollover when the rollover index is above a predetermined threshold.

Abstract
A method is provided for detecting a rollover event of a vehicle. A lateral kinetic energy of the vehicle is determined in response to vehicle longitudinal velocity and vehicle side slip angle. A lateral acceleration of the vehicle is measured. A tire normal force is measured. A rollover potentiality index is determined in response to the lateral kinetic energy and the lateral acceleration. A rollover index is determined by weighting the rollover potentiality index by a factor of the lateral acceleration and by a factor of the tire normal force. A comparison is made to determine if the rollover index is above a predetermined threshold.
